NORTH WALES COAST WEST LEAGUE: Wins for Nantlle, Blaenau and Llanrug

Blaenau Amateurs celebrated a 5-1 win on the toad last Saturday

NORTH WALES COAST WEST LEAGUE – REPORTS FOR DEC 13

PREMIER DIVISION

Nantlle Vale 5 CPD Penrhyndeudraeth 0

Nantlle Vale made sure they will enter 2026 as Premier Division leaders after a convincing five-goal victory over Penrhyndeudraeth on Saturday.

Vale led 1-0 at half time, Llion Griffiths providing the sixth-minute goal via an Alex Kalafusz assist.

A second home goal did not arrive until the 61st minute, Ashley Owen scoring for the sixth game in a row and making it 13 for the first team this season, Griffiths this time assisting.

Aaron Griffiths added a third on 71, Owen setting up the chance.

A fourth followed after 84 before Carter Davies made it 5-0 with 89 on the clock.

CPD Mynydd Llandegai 1 Blaenau Ffestiniog Amateurs 5

Ceri Roberts

Fine result on the road for Blaenau, who are up to a creditable fifth place in their first season at Premier level.

Hosts Llandegai struck first, Shaun Morris converting an eighth minute penalty, but Iwan Jones soon equalised with 10 gone.

The Quarrymen were in total control by half time, popular veteran Ceri Roberts making it 2-1 before Sion Roberts put away a spot-kick.

And that man Ceri Roberts was on the mark again before the interval with his second of the afternoon.

Assists in the first half arrived via Carwyn Jones, Deio Williams and Sion Roberts.

No further goals landed until the 93rd minute when Carwyn Jones made it 5-1, Sion Roberts with his second assist.

Llanrug United 3 Gwalchmai 0

Victorious Llanrug edged up to 10th in the standings at the expense of bottom side Gwalchmai, who are still attempting to get their first win.

Berian Llwyd broke the deadlock on 22 minutes, Deion Hughes with the assist.

Just 1-0 at the break, but on 63 the home advantage was doubled when Kevin Lloyd pocketed his 14th goal of the campaign, Owain Jones teeing up the scorer.

Hughes made sure of the honours with goal number three after 84 minutes, Tom Verburg in the assister’s role.
